Holt County is seeking to purchase the Missouri Department of Transportation’s Maintenance Barn at Oregon.
The County Commission has offered MoDOT $80,000 to purchase the buildings and five acres of land, with a $10,000 down payment, $30,000 paid this December, $20,000 in 2013, and $20,000 in 2014.
The Missouri Department of Transportation closed its Oregon facility last year and consolidated operations in Holt County at its Mound City facility, as a cost-savings measure.
Holt County has expressed interest in purchasing the MoDOT facility to replace the current county barn, which consist of two metal sheds in Oregon. County officials say the MoDOT barn would offer the county more room to store its trucks and machinery.
Holt County Commissioners also plan to have the current county barn appraised and sold to help offset the costs of purchasing the MoDOT facility.
The county has yet to receive a response from MoDOT officials to the county’s offer.
